## Releases

Liftwright simulator releases are cut from `stable` weekly. Tag, run `make dist`, then sign the tarball before upload. CI rejects unsigned artifacts. Verify locally with `lw-verify dist/*.tar.gz`. Release notes go in `RELEASES.md`, newest first. The signing key used for all Liftwright release artifacts is shown below.

release key, yagap-kagag: bky6_1ks93y

Handover note — Crumbwheel order cutoffs.

Welcome aboard. The bakery cutoff rule in Crumbwheel closes same-day orders at 14:00 local to each storefront, not UTC — this has bitten us twice. Holiday overrides live in the calendar service and take precedence silently, so always check there first when a cutoff looks wrong. To unlock the calendar service's admin console after a restart, enter the recovery passphrase below.

vault phrase of bagap-bahaf = silion-pelox-sorox-casdor-quenwyn-fraax-eliox-praael-kelion-quenvan-kasox-rusael-norius-belvan

Visitors to the Hollowmere campus may not use the staff bike cage; guest bicycles should be left at the racks beside the east parking gate. The parking gates open automatically for registered visitor plates, so please submit plate numbers to reception at least one day ahead. Assistants escorting visitors through the gatehouse on foot will need to present the gate pass below at the barrier intercom.

turnstile pass: bdg-TXR-4

## Authentication

Heads up: the nightly reindex job (`reindex_nightly.py`) talks to the Lanternfish search cluster, and that cluster won't accept anonymous writes anymore — we locked it down last sprint. The job now authenticates as the `reindex-runner` service identity against Corvid Gateway, and the token is injected via the `LF_INDEX_TOKEN` env var in the scheduler config. Nothing clever going on, just a bearer header on every batch request. For review purposes, the staging credential currently in use is listed below.

service key, kadug-kadup: kto15_rN23XLAYImmZgrJ